Frequently asked questions about hotels in Spain

  • What are the best landmarks to visit in Spain?

    Spain boasts incredible landmarks! The Alhambra in Granada is a breathtaking palace and fortress, a masterpiece of Moorish architecture. The Sagrada Familia in Barcelona, Gaudí's unfinished masterpiece, is awe-inspiring. The Alcázar of Seville, a royal palace showcasing Mudéjar style, is another must-see. And don't forget the Mezquita-Cathedral of Córdoba, a unique blend of mosque and cathedral.

  • What are hotels like in Spain?

    Spain offers a range of hotels and resorts. You have large resorts on the Costas, offering all-inclusive packages and a range of facilities. You have the historic luxury Paradors, heritage hotels set in historic palaces and monasteries. You can also find quaint bed and breakfasts, guest houses, hotels of varying standards, and hostels all across Spain.
  • What are some must-do activities in Spain?

    So much to do! Explore the vibrant tapas bars of San Sebastián, indulging in pintxos. Wander through the charming streets of Seville, perhaps taking a flamenco show in the evening. Relax on the beaches of the Costa Brava or the Costa del Sol. Hike in the Picos de Europa national park, enjoying stunning mountain scenery. Or visit the Prado Museum in Madrid, home to masterpieces of Spanish art.

  • What are the most popular destinations in Spain?

    The most popular destination in Spain is Barcelona, followed shortly by the Spanish capital, Madrid, and the Andalucian city of Seville. Another popular destination is the island of Mallorca, the Costas along the eastern and southern coasts of Spain, and the Balearic islands.
  • When is the ideal time to visit Spain?

    Spring (April-May) and autumn (September-October) offer pleasant temperatures and fewer crowds than the peak summer months. Summer (June-August) can be very hot, especially in the south, but perfect for beach holidays. Winter (November-March) is mild in the south but can be chilly in the north.

  • How can I get around Spain the best?

    If you're looking to travel long distances across Spain, then you can take the high-speed train (AVE, short for Alta Velodicad), which connects most of Spain's major cities. This can be a pricy way to get around. Alternatively, there are slower trains and long-distance buses you can take to get around the country.
  • Which regions or areas are best for spending a week in Spain?

    Andalusia offers a rich blend of culture, history, and beaches. Catalonia provides a vibrant city life in Barcelona and stunning coastal scenery. The Basque Country is known for its gastronomy and beautiful landscapes. A week in any of these regions will give you a great taste of Spain.

  • What are the must-try dishes in Spain?

    Spanish cuisine is diverse, depending on what region you're in, but there are a few staples that are synonymous with Spain. The first is paella, a saffron-hued rice dish from Valencia that's either served with meat or seafood. Another is patatas bravas, which is fried potatoes served with a spicy pepper sauce. Of course, there is the tortilla, the Spanish omelet made with potatoes and onions, and gazpacho, a cold tomato and vegetable soup. Then there is various produce you must try, like the Jamon Iberico (Spanish cured ham), queso manchego (a local hard cheese), and chorizo (a spicy sausage). Of course, all washed down with excellent Spanish wines from Rioja or Ribera del Duero.
  • Which parts of Spain are perfect for a weekend getaway?

    Seville is easily explored in a weekend, offering its Alcázar, Cathedral, and flamenco. San Sebastián provides a perfect foodie escape with its pintxos. Madrid offers world-class museums and vibrant nightlife. Barcelona is another excellent choice, though a weekend might only scratch the surface.

  • Where should I stay in Spain for Las Falles?

    La Falles is a festival that takes place in the city of Valencia, so you'll want to book a hotel here if you want to attend this festival. Make sure you book far in advance!
  • Is renting a car recommended for exploring Spain?

    It depends on your plans. A car is beneficial for exploring rural areas and smaller towns, offering flexibility. However, cities like Madrid and Barcelona have excellent public transport, and parking can be challenging and expensive. Consider your itinerary carefully.
  • What are the best hotels with a swimming pool in Spain?

    Forum Boutique Hotel & Spa - Adults Only, Vincci Selección Aleysa and La Almunia Del Valle are among the best hotels with a swimming pool in Spain.

  • Are credit cards widely accepted in Spain?

    Yes, major credit cards are widely accepted in most tourist areas and larger establishments. However, it's always a good idea to have some cash on hand for smaller businesses or rural areas.
  • What are the largest airports in Spain?

    Madrid-Barajas Airport (MAD) and Barcelona-El Prat Airport (BCN) are the largest and busiest airports in Spain, serving as major international hubs.
  • Are there any unwritten rules of behaviour visitors should know about Spain?

    It's customary to greet people with a kiss on each cheek (beso). Lunch is often the main meal of the day, and dinner is typically eaten later than in some other countries. Siestas are still common in some areas, with many businesses closing for a few hours in the afternoon. Learning a few basic Spanish phrases is always appreciated.
  • What local specialties should you try in Spain?

    Paella, a rice dish with seafood or meat, is a must-try. Tapas, small snacks served in bars, offer a wide variety of flavours. Gazpacho, a cold tomato soup, is refreshing in the summer. Try churros con chocolate for a sweet treat. And don't forget the local wines!
  • Where are the best shopping spots in Spain?

    Madrid's Gran Vía and Salamanca district offer high-end shopping. Barcelona's Passeig de Gràcia features flagship stores and designer boutiques. Seville's Alameda de Hércules has a bohemian vibe with unique shops. Smaller towns often have charming local markets selling artisan crafts.
  • What signature events or festivals take place in Spain?

    La Tomatina (Buñol), a tomato-throwing festival, is famously unique. Las Fallas (Valencia) features giant papier-mâché figures. Semana Santa (Holy Week) is celebrated across the country with elaborate processions. Many local fiestas take place throughout the year, offering a taste of Spanish culture.
  • What’s the best place in Spain for mild and comfortable weather?

    The Canary Islands, particularly Tenerife and Gran Canaria, offer consistently mild weather year-round due to their subtropical climate. The Costa del Sol also enjoys warm weather for much of the year.
  • What are the most common travel mistakes tourists make in Spain?

    Not learning basic Spanish phrases, expecting everything to be open late, not booking accommodation or transportation in advance, particularly during peak season, and underestimating the heat during summer months are common mistakes.
  • What are some hidden gems to explore in Spain?

    The charming town of Ronda in Andalusia, with its dramatic Puente Nuevo bridge, is a hidden gem. The stunning beaches of the Costa de la Luz, less crowded than other coastal areas, are worth exploring. The medieval city of Toledo, a UNESCO World Heritage site, offers a captivating journey through history.
